How can i keep fresh cut tulips alive?

How can i keep fresh cut tulips alive? To keep cut tulips fresh and vigorous, be sure to keep the water in the vase “topped off” with fresh cold water every day or two. Flowers kept in a cool location in a room will also last much longer. Change the water completely every couple of days to prolong your flower’s life.

How do you care for tulips in a vase indoors? Tulips look fabulous in a vase, either on their own or combined with other spring flowers. Cut them as the color just starts to show; they will continue to open fully and should last for around 5 days. Keep the vase topped up with cold water. Cut tulips will last longer in a cool room and out of direct sunlight.

When do tulips bloom in washington state?

A: The Tulip Festival is held from April 1-30 annually. However, mother nature determines when the tulips bloom. Some years the tulips are blooming the last week of March and other years they may not bloom until the second week of April. Also, there are different varieties of tulips that bloom earlier and later.

When should you plant tulip bulbs in illinois?

A: October is the ideal time to plant tulips, daffodils and other spring-flowering bulbs in Iowa and Illinois. This way they have sufficient time to develop a good root system before the ground freezes in winter. If the weather permits, tulips and other spring-flowering bulbs can be planted as late as late November.

Can you fertilize tulips in spring?

Do not fertilize tulips in spring. The roots of the bulb will be dying off shortly after that in order to be dormant for the summer and will not be able to take up the optimal amount of nutrients from the tulip bulb fertilizer.

How long do tulip bulbs bloom?

During a cool spring, with temperatures between 45-55 degrees Fahrenheit, tulips will bloom for 1-2 weeks but if the weather is warmer, each bloom will last for just a few days.

Can tulips be planted in muddy soil?

It is best to stay out of a garden that has wet soil, if possible. Bulbs grow best in well-drained soils and may rot if planted in soils that are too wet for an extended length of time. … Spring flowering bulbs, like tulips, can be planted in fall until the soil begins to freeze.

Can you save tulip bulbs?

After blooming, allow the foliage to wither and die back, then dig the tulips up. Clean off the soil and let the bulbs dry. … Store the bulbs in nets or paper bags. Label them and keep in a cool dark place before replanting them in the fall.

Why do we celebrate tulip festival?

The Canadian Tulip Festival was established to celebrate the historic Royal gift of tulips from the Dutch to Canadians immediately following the Second World War as a symbol of international friendship.

How to make tulips stand up straight?

Put a penny in the water, and set it aside. Then, prep your flowers by removing the bottom one or two leaves–just enough to keep the leaves out of the water but still have some on top. Cut all of the stems at a 45-degree angle, and put them back in the vase. After about an hour, they’ll be standing straight up!

When can you plant tulips bulbs?

The best time to plant tulips is November-December. If the bulbs are planted earlier they will start to grow and this may result in frost damage to the shoots. They will grow in any reasonable soil, as long as it does not get waterlogged, and they do best in full sun, but tolerate some shade.

When to plant tulips in edmonton?

Plant tulips from early- to late-September. They need time to take in nutrients, sprout roots and establish themselves before freeze-up. Give them longer to establish themselves and you’ll be treated to a rewarding spring show.
